Spherical isotropy representations [PDF]
An old question of P. A. Smith considers a finite group G acting smoothly on a closed homotopy sphere \(\Sigma\) with \(\Sigma^ G\) consisting of precisely two points and asks whether the representations of G on the tangent spaces at the two fixed points are the same. This would be true, obviously, for a linear action on a sphere.
